Summary

The Engineer supports the daily operation and upkeep of the property by maintaining guest cottages, common areas, and resort equipment. This hands-on role helps ensure the resort remains safe, functional, and guest-ready through routine maintenance, repairs, and preventive care.

Responsibilities

  • Perform routine maintenance and repairs involving electrical, plumbing, HVAC, and general building systems
  • Troubleshoot and repair resort equipment, facilities, pools, and common-area systems
  • Respond to maintenance requests from guests and team members in a timely and professional manner
  • Complete preventive maintenance tasks to help reduce equipment downtime and service interruptions
  • Inspect resort facilities regularly to identify maintenance or safety concerns
  • Maintain clean, safe, and organized work areas while following company safety procedures
  • Assist during emergencies such as power outages, severe weather, or equipment failures
  • Work closely with other departments to support smooth day-to-day resort operations
  • Keep accurate records of completed work orders, repairs, and inspections
  • Support additional maintenance projects and operational tasks as assigned

Qualifications

  • High school diploma or equivalent required
  • Previous maintenance experience preferred, ideally in hospitality, resort, campground, or property maintenance settings
  • Working knowledge of electrical, plumbing, HVAC, and general repair techniques
  • Ability to troubleshoot and complete basic repairs independently
  • Strong communication and problem-solving skills
  • Comfortable working both independently and as part of a team
  • Valid driver's license preferred
  • Ability to lift up to 50 lbs. and work indoors/outdoors in varying conditions
  • Flexible availability including weekends and holidays

Position Details & Benefits

  • Full-time seasonal position located in Berlin, MD
  • Flexible scheduling required, including mornings, evenings, weekends, and holidays
  • Benefits include Paid Sick Time, team member travel discounts, and additional resort perks
